@@ -309,6 +317,29 @@ hpux_core_core_file_p (abfd)
 
   /* OK, we believe you.  You're a core file (sure, sure).  */
 
+  /* On HP/UX, we sometimes encounter core files where none of the threads
+     was found to be the running thread (ie the signal was set to -1 for
+     all threads).  This happens when the program was aborted externally
+     via a TT_CORE ttrace system call.  In that case, we just pick one
+     thread at random to be the active thread.  */
+  if (core_kernel_thread_id (abfd) != 0
+      && bfd_get_section_by_name (abfd, ".reg") == NULL)
+    {
+      asection *asect = bfd_sections_find_if (abfd, thread_section_p, NULL);
+      asection *reg_sect;
+
+      if (asect != NULL)
+        {
+          reg_sect = make_bfd_asection (abfd, ".reg", asect->flags,
+                                        asect->size, asect->vma,
+                                        asect->alignment_power);
+          if (reg_sect == NULL)
+            goto fail;
+
+          reg_sect->filepos = asect->filepos;
+        }
+    }
+
